Apple buttermilk muffins recipe details
- Ingredients:
- 3/4 cup brown sugar, firmly packed
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 2 eggs, lightly beaten
- 1-1/2 teaspoons vanilla
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
- 1-1/2 cups apple, peeled and chopped
- 3/4 cup buttermilk
- Topping:
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up chopped pecans
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ease muffin cups or use paper liners.
Blend 3/4 cup brown sugar, oil, eggs, and vanilla in a large bowl. Combine flour, baking soda, salt, and spices. Add to wet mixture. Add apple and buttermilk and mix thoroughly just to moisten. Fill muffin cups 2/3 full. Combine 1/4 cup sugar, pecans, and cinnamon in a small bowl for topping. Sprinkle evenly over batter. Bake at 350 degrees for 20 to 25 minutes.
Makes: 12 muffins
